Synopsis "Mexican American Women Activists"
Tells the stories of Mexican American women from two Los Angeles neighborhoods and how they transformed the everyday problems they confronted into political concerns. By placing these women's experiences at the center of her discussion of grassroots political activism, the author describes gender, race, and class character of community networking.
